Method of Making an ARTICLE OF FOOTWEAR
A method of manufacturing a panel for an article of apparel includes stretching a base layer from a resting configuration to a stretched configuration. The method further includes coupling a reinforcement layer to the base layer when the base layer is in the stretched configuration. The method also includes applying an auxetic structure to the reinforcement layer when the base layer is in the stretched configuration. The auxetic structure includes a plurality of interconnected members defining a repeating pattern of voids, and each void has a reentrant shape. The method further includes releasing the base layer to allow the base layer to return to the resting configuration.
Footwear With Refractive Internal Illumination
A footwear with refractive internal illumination has a footwear, a translucent body, an illumination system and a liner. The footwear has a sole section and an upper. The upper has an opaque light refracting section. The illumination system has a power source and at least one light source. The at least one light source is electrically connected to the power source. A light wavelength of light emitted from the at least one light source is approximate to a light wavelength of light emitted through the opaque light refracting section. The upper is connected to the sole section. The at least one light source is connected to the translucent body. The translucent body is housed in between the liner and the opaque light refracting section.

Shoe/boot with replaceable water-proof sock
A shoe/boot includes an outsole and a vamp, and a first opening is defined in the top of the shoe/boot. A first connection portion is located along the periphery of the first opening. A water-proof sock is inserted into the first opening and has a second opening defined in the top thereof A second connection portion is formed at the periphery of the second opening. The first connection portion is detachably connected to the second connection portion to secure the water-proof sock to the shoe/boot. The water-proof sock can be removed from the shoe/boot by separating the first connection portion from the second connection portion.

SOFT SHELL BOOTS AND WATERPROOF/BREATHABLE MOISTURE TRANSFER COMPOSITES AND LINER FOR IN-LINE SKATES, ICE-SKATES, HOCKEY SKATES, SNOWBOARD BOOTS, APLPINE BOOTS, HIKING BOOTS AND THE LIKE
The soft boot and liner include a moisture transfer system that includes an inner fabric layer carefully selected from technically advanced fabrics. A series of layers are provided outside the inner liner including foam material layers, spacer fabrics and breathable membranes, in various orders. Encapsulation technology and waterproofing are used as well. The outer fabric layer is also capable of working with the other layers to promote the transfer of moisture. Frothed foams and flocking with fibers are further characteristics of the present invention. The moisture transfer system is incorporated into a soft boot or skate or as a removable liner for a shell boot. Numerous other modifications and applications are disclosed.

STATIC DISSIPATING AND CONDUCTIVE FOOTWEAR
A static dissipating or conductive article of footwear with an electrical flow path in the upper. The upper includes at least one conductive element extending along at least a portion of the inside of the upper in a position where it will directly contact the wearer's foot. The upper may include a plurality of conductive elements located in different regions. The conductive elements may be positioned in line with a lacing system so that tightening of the laces urges the conductive elements toward the wearer's foot. The conductive elements may be a ribbon or other strip of fabric that includes one or more conductive threads. The ribbon or fabric strip may be woven in and out of a lining material on the inside of the upper.
Lining for items of clothing, footwear or accessories
A lining for items of clothing, footwear and accessories, including a fabric with a plurality of channels which are alternated with ribs, the channels at least partly have a differentiated width.
